Transaction 693b4a9c82dcc98bd2b5628696c42caa23da79ebbdeae15eb7e0e3edd90cc145

2 Input
2 Outputs
  • 693b4a9c82dcc98bd2b5628696c42caa23da79ebbdeae15eb7e0e3edd90cc145:0
  • value  4888
    address  1K83228FWWCih8nzN3AdA4f7z5XfsrHTB5
  • 693b4a9c82dcc98bd2b5628696c42caa23da79ebbdeae15eb7e0e3edd90cc145:1
  • value  29859035
    address  3EAgYHadGdRNbHHV8LTc9mi8v3uUJ3tDoz